Good morning, sully tells me that I can find out anything about my 72 c-3 on this forum so I am using his post until mine is approved. Anyway, I have changed the trans from a t400 to a 700r4 but now that it’s all back together it will not start. The only thing I can think of is the switch on the shifter itself, any ideas on how to test or adjust the switch?
The car has a remote starter solenoid due to the headers but all was working fine until the trans change. When I turn the key the volt meter shows a good charge but then nothing happens, no click, motor dosnt turn or anything? Any ideas at this point would help.

Did you have the shifter out altering it to have the 4 positions, and maybe forgot to plug in the neutral safety switch connector? See the following url for troubleshooting help.. Note bottom diagram shows automatic.

power shows on the ammeter and when the ignition switch is turned nothing happens at the engine... still thinking something with the neutral safety switch... opened center consol and the safety switch looks like it has been bypassed.... purple large guage 2 wire coming out of the harness there is bypassed... off the neutral safety switch is the two pink wires and one green..... the green and one of the pinks goes to a two plug harness that I know is for the rear backup lamps... but what is the other pink wire.... and does it even matter if the purple wires are bypassed and already linked together?
